问题描述
- 急求解决,jsp页面中循环生成的form表单,action路径错误
-
在jsp页面中用循环生成的form表单,为什么action不是想要的呢,代码贴在下面了reply=(Map)request.getAttribute("REPLY");
while(rsComment.next())
{
// 评论编号
String CId = rsComment.getString("CId");
// 评论人
String name=rsComment.getString("UserName");
//评论内容
String content=rsComment.getString("content");
//评论时间
String date=Convert.ToString(rsComment.getDate("addtime"));
%>???? 删除评论
</td> </tr> <% } %> <tr> <form action="/Blog/servlet/AddComment" method="post" onsubmit="return ValidateAddComment();"> <input type="hidden" name="AId" value="<%=AId%>"/> <input type="hidden" name="UId" value="<%=UId%>"/> <td></td> <td style="width:50%;text-align:left;"><textarea name="content" cols="50" rows="2"></textarea></td> <td style="text-align:left;"><input type="submit" value="评论"/></td> </form> </tr> </table>
action 跳转的路径不是servlet/AddComment却是 servlet/ArticleList
解决方案
像我们一般发生这种情况的话都是检查一下web.xml文件的路径和表单提交的路径是否相同,或者是重新部署一下。
时间: 2024-09-12 07:26:59